For the weekly sync: the March incident traced back to CACHE_TTL_SECONDS being set to 86400 in staging and copied to prod during the Larkspur migration. Price updates sat stale for a day. Fixes shipped: TTL lowered to 300, a cache-bust hook added on catalog writes, and a config diff check in the deploy pipeline. One remaining action item is re-provisioning the cache cluster credentials, since the old ones were shared across environments. The new cache cluster access secret should be set on the line below.

vault entry, yahif-yajep: COURIER_KEY29=b802bdf8034096b65a51c6ba5abe2

Handover note — HaulMetric fuel report

Taking over from me is straightforward. The fleet fuel-usage report for Brindle Logistics runs nightly and aggregates pump telemetry from each depot gateway. If support gets tickets about missing rows, it's almost always a stale gateway token or the Ostvale depot clock drifting again — restart the collector and re-run the 02:00 job. The report thresholds and refresh cadence live in one place, so check there before touching code. For reference, the service is currently configured with the following values.

config for kawif-hahig:
zorix:
  log_level: error
  metrics_host: metrics.zorix.lumiclabs.internal
  pool_size: 16

**Mgmt Meeting Minutes — Retiring the Brightline Range**

Quick recap for sales leads at Fenholt Supplies: we agreed to retire the Brightline fixture range by year-end. Remaining stock moves to clearance pricing next month, and accounts on standing orders get migrated to the Lumetta range. Trade-in incentives were approved in principle. The confidential note on next steps sits just below.

board note of bajof-bajeg: The pricing group signed off on a budget of $13.4 million for Project Sildor. The renewal with Lamixek Holdings closes at $48.9 million a year, 49 percent above the last contract.

Subject: Pricing review — Meridia Sensor Line

Executive team,

Following the board's request, we have completed the pricing analysis for the Meridia sensor line. Margins on the entry tier have eroded to 18% due to component costs, while the premium tier holds at 41%. We propose a 6% uplift on entry models and bundled service contracts for premium, effective next quarter. Regional impact assessments are attached. The confidential rationale for the board follows below.

internal memo for bahap-yagug: Headcount on the Ulaix team goes from 3 to 100 by the end of January. Gross margin on Ulaix came in at 10 percent against a plan of 15 percent.